3.    Headboard Styles in the Bedroom

At times a bedroom calls for a stylish element. A headboard can most definitely be an essential piece of furniture as it’s a detail that completes a bedroom.

Opting for carved wooden headboards can help you achieve a touch of ethnicity or a chic bohemian vibe.

However, a headboard made from wooden panels is sure to act as an attractive focal point, especially in smaller bedrooms. A velvet headboard can transform your blank walls into a sophisticated bedroom wall with a floor-to-ceiling design.

What’s more, a POP headboard can lend a romantic vibe to most contemporary bedrooms. The most commonly preferred tufted headboard adds elegance to many spaces and is also available in various colors.

4.    Space-Efficient And Multi-Functional Wardrobes

Have you ever thought about your bedroom’s potential?

It doesn’t only have to be a place to sleep. It can be a library, a dressing area, an entertainment zone, a study, and so much more! Space-efficient and multi-functional wardrobes consider the space constraints most modern homes face.

A good combination is a wardrobe-cum-TV-unit, for instance. Getting a TV unit and wardrobe would mean you need to sort out space for two items separately.

However, this won’t be an issue with a wardrobe-cum-TV-unit. With this, you can have your TV stand in the middle of your wardrobe, or you can mount the TV. In both ways, that’ll give your room a clutter-free look!

5.    Smart Storage

Everyone has encountered the feeling of stowing away junk under the bed to hide that unsightly clutter. But before giving in to the temptation, there’s one more thing you can do.

Enter wicker baskets. These are affordable ways to add storage to your bedroom. By lining up wicker baskets, you can place the nitty-gritty items that don’t have any place in your home inside these. There are various shapes and sizes for these baskets that you can choose according to the stuff that needs to go in. Also, be sure to cover them and save them from dust and grime.
